Mixed anxiety depressive disorder
Mixed anxiety-depressive disorder (MADD) is found among those who suffer from depression and anxiety symptoms at the same time. In this way, the unique set of symptoms do not meet the diagnosis requirements of simply an anxiety disorder or a depression disorder.
Common signs of mixed anxiety-depressive disorder include the following:
Excessive worry
Feeling hopeless, pessimistic, or worthless
Lack of energy or motivation
Frequent crying
Feelings of loneliness or isolation
Irritability
Difficulty concentrating or sleeping
Suicidal thoughts or behavior
If these symptoms a) continue for at least 4 weeks, b) are not caused by medications, drugs, or another health condition, and c) are affecting one’s ability to function normally, then mixed anxiety-depressive disorder may be a likely diagnosis.
